Quick report

The warm and incremental snowfall over the last week has improved snow depths throughout the area, but hasn't loaded things enough to crush and consolidate weaker snow in the middle snowpack. Snow that fell wet and heavy a couple of days ago has dried out, creating more desirable travel conditions with fewer exposed hazards, but our snowpack remains punchy with few supportive layers within its structure. Expect to find about a meter of total snow at Thompson Pass road level up to 3500 feet, with higher amounts in upper elevations. Big weather changes are in the near future and will bring cold and windy conditions to our area by the weekend. Our first forecast will be published at 8 am tomorrow. Stay tuned for updates as conditions change.

Cloudy and foggy down low. Temperatures at road level were just below freezing, with noticeably cooler temps at 3300'. Light snowfall, winds to 5mph, and generally mild conditions.

Snowpack

The wet snowfall over the last couple of days has dried/cooled and formed a 2cm-thick rain crust that can be found up to 3000'.  Continuous incremental snowfall over the last week has formed slabs 1-2 feet thick in the observed area. Weak faceted snow and, in some areas, surface hoar underlie this slab, which has been reactive in pit tests and on small test slopes.  Today, an Extended Column Test (ECT) produced propagation on the 18th tap (ECTP18), down 44cm on the faceted old-new interface. (See pit for details). Snowpack height averaged about 1 meter from the parking lot to 3300' and still showed fairly low strength in the mid-pack. Boot penetration is still 60 cm or more, and snowmachines can easily punch through to the ground when riding aggressively.
